Some years back I met a young couple that had done a round Anglesey trip in an even smaller sportboat. It started out lovely, but there are some quite dodgy bits when you go round the corners of Anglesey. I met them at PD, she was white & shivering & he was suffering from the first stages of hypothermia! But they hadn't planned the trip or prepared properly. I reckon they either learnt a lot, or sold the boat next day! Good to see you doing it properly!
